Apple Cinnamon Muffins Recipe
Description: These homemade Apple Cinnamon Muffins are moist and fluffy, with juicy, sweet apples in every bite. And the streusel crumb topping is absolutely delicious!
Ingredients
- ⅓ cup all-purpose flour ($0.10)
- ⅓ cup brown sugar, packed ($0.24)
- ½ tsp ground cinnamon ($0.05)
- 3 Tbsp salted cold butter, cubed ($0.42)
- 2 small apples ($1.05)
- 1 ¾ cup all-purpose flour ($0.40)
- 1 tsp baking powder ($0.10)
- ½ tsp baking soda ($0.05)
- ½ tsp salt ($0.02)
- 1 ½ tsp cinnamon ($0.15)
- ¼ tsp nutmeg ($0.05)
- ½ cup brown sugar ($0.30)
- ¼ cup white sugar ($0.08)
- ¼ cup plain yogurt ($0.30)
- ½ cup sweetened applesauce ($0.32)
- ¼ cup vegetable oil ($0.32)
- 2 large eggs, room temperature ($0.49)
- 1 ½ tsp vanilla extract ($0.45)
Instructions
- Combine
- Preheat the oven to 350°F. Start by making the crumb mixture. In a medium bowl whisk together the all-purpose flour, brown sugar, and cinnamon. Then add the cubed cold butter to the bowl. Combine the butter and the flour mixture together with a fork, pastry cutter, or clean hands. Once the mixture is well combined and crumbly, set it to the side.
- Dice
- Next wash, peel, and remove the core from the apples. Dice the apples into small cubes. I like to first slice the apples, then cut them into strips, then dice them into small cubes. Set the diced apples to the side.
- Whisk
- Now in a large bowl add the dry ingredients for the muffins (all-purpose flour, baking powder, baking soda, salt, cinnamon, and nutmeg). Whisk together until combined.
- Mix
- In a separate bowl combine the wet ingredients together (brown sugar, white sugar, plain yogurt, applesauce, oil, eggs, and vanilla extract. Mix together until well combined.
- Stir
- Add the dry ingredients to the same bowl as the wet ingredients. Stir together until just combined. Be careful not to overmix at this point.
- Fold
- Add the diced apples to the bowl and fold them into the batter until just combined.
- Divide the batter between ten greased or lined muffin wells (I used butter to grease my muffin wells really well).
- Top
- Now divide and top each muffin with the streusel crumble mixture.
- Bake the muffins in the preheated oven for 26-28 minutes or until golden brown and a toothpick inserted comes out clean. Allow the muffins to cool for about 5 minutes, then carefully loosen the edges with a knife and transfer the muffins to a wire rack to finish cooling. Enjoy!
